Abstract

The paper investigates the topic of the Boxers Rebellion (1898–1901) in the Chinese literature, as in late Qing novels, as in contemporary literature. In particular, "The tanci of the national calamity of 1900" (1901) written by Li Baojia, “Sea of Woe” (1906) by Wu Woyao, “Divine fist” (1963) by Lao She and several novels by Feng Jicai are analyzed in order to trace different approaches to the Boxers, to the Imperial Court and to the foreign armies and international military intervention.

Feng Jicai`s first historical novels, in particular “Yihequan” (1977, co-written with Li Dingxing) and “The Miraculous Lamp” (1979) are focused on the Boxers rebellion in Tianjin, they represent the concept of public revenge as upholding of moral justice. His story “The Miraculous Braid” though describes magical beliefs as the core of the Boxers ideology. The last novel, “Monocular Telescope” (2018) also describes events in Tianjin that have been occurred during the Boxers rebellion, but it is very different from the previous two. It can be treated as an example of Sino-western cultural clash.
